William Foster Sergeant 1826

William Foster Sergeant was born in Lincolnshire in 1826. His father, also William Foster Sergeant, emigrated with his wife and 7 children to Adelaide in 1838, where he established a successful farm on the Sturt river at Marion. The gold rush in Victoria may have attracted young William as he married Bridget McGuire at Geelong in 1858 when he was 33. Their first four children were born at The Leigh (Shelford), then three sons were born at Rokewood from 1868-1873. Two children died around that time. William was a farmer at Rokewood when his eldest daughter Catherine married in 1881. In 1889 his remaining daughter married at Shelford. Both daughters lived in Melbourne and his wife died in Prahran in 1894. William was living with his daughter Alice when he died in 1902 and was buried at St Kilda cemetery. His occupation was given as an old age pensioner and labourer.
